MEP 2012 Pipe Fitting issues?

I'm having issues with 2012 MEP pipe fittings. Some insert the wrong size despite my specifically asking for the correct size, some also insert incorrectly... transitions for example will occasionally insert not only the wrong size but with the larger end on the smaller pipe and the smaller end on the larger pipe. i'm perplexed... been using MEP since 2008 and I'm no expert (like many I've seen in this forum) but it's not often i'm seeing wacky things like this that I can't figure out on my own.
